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Obfuscation Handling
    While JADX can handle some obfuscation, highly obfuscated code can still pose challenges, affecting the readability and accuracy of the decompiled source.
  • Resource Intensive
    JADX can be resource-heavy during decompilation, which may lead to performance issues on lower-end machines or when dealing with large APK files.
  • Incomplete Code Conversion
    In certain complex cases, Decompiled Java code might not always compile back perfectly due to incompleteness or inaccuracies in the conversion process.
  • Limited Interactive Debugging
    JADX lacks sophisticated interactive debugging features, which can make it challenging to analyze dynamic behavior or runtime issues.
